Indications of Ampicillin Powder Veterinary 20%

Ampicillin is considered one of the penicillin derivatives which are active against gram-positive bacteria such as staphylococcus pneumococcus and gram-negative bacteria such as gonococcus and meningococcus .it are a bacteriostat and bactericide. The product is used to treat infections caused by bacteria as in the following cases. 1-to treat gastrointestinal and respiratory infections in calves and poultry. 2- to treat urinary and biliary passages infection in sheep, goats, calves and poultry. 3- to treat infection caused by salmonella bacteria in calves 4- to treat sepsis of bee insulator

Usage and Dosage for Ampicillin Powder Veterinary 20%

it is used with drinking water for calves, sheep, Goats, poultry and bee as follow : For treatment: 200 g /200-litre water or 5g /100 kg body weight. For protective: 100 g /200-litre water or 2.5 g/100kg body weight. (the treatment continues for3-5 days )

Warnings

do not give it for animal sensitive to penicillin or have renal failure.

Withdrawal Period

for meat 10 days, for milk 3 days
